Tree nut growing is a type of crop farming that involves the cultivation of tree nuts, such as almonds, walnuts, pecans, and hazelnuts. Tree nut farming is a labor-intensive process that requires careful management of soil, water, and nutrients. The trees must be pruned and harvested at the right time to ensure a good yield. Tree nut farming is a long-term investment, as it can take several years for a tree to reach maturity and produce a crop.
Tree nut farming is a lucrative business, as tree nuts are in high demand for their nutritional value and culinary uses. Tree nut farming is also an environmentally friendly form of agriculture, as it requires minimal use of pesticides and fertilizers.
Some companies in the tree nut growing market include Blue Diamond Growers, Diamond Foods, and Paramount Farms. These companies produce a variety of tree nuts for both the retail and wholesale markets. Show Less Read more
